In this paper, we present the results of a study conducted in the province of Castellón (Spain). It arises from the idea that f
or
moving towards an inclusive education models is necessary, first
of all, that educators and families understand the meaning of
inclusion and, secondly, to know the benefits generated by inclusive education. We analyze the conceptions and beliefs that
families of our context have over inclusive education model.
This is a quantitative cross sectional study in which over-scale
questionnaire, 33 parents expressed their views over this topic. It
also aims to see whether there are differences in beliefs of
families who have children with disabilities
and families without it. After obtaining th
e results, they are analyzed and discus
sed at
the end of work. [-]
